For a club with such a terrible record, their supporters are unbelievably arrogant.Essendon will win another final before St Kilda wins another premiership. Essendon have won 69 finals. St Kilda have won one premiership.
Essendon's current problem is they have been stuck in an eddy of mediocrity: never really bottoming out for long (2016 spoon notwithstanding), never being good enough to win a final. They need to rebuild, and they can't do it effectively until Tasmania is established as the 19th team. I'm expecting their next finals win in about 2034.
Essendon's speciality seems to be making finals only to lose various elimination finals in the first week, which they've done 26 times, including their last six finals. The current winless streak is not the only time Essendon were mocked for losing finals. They also didn't win any finals in the 1970s and early 1980s, losing five elimination finals in 11 years. They've won 16 premierships, so they get finals right sometimes.
St Kilda have always been a rubbish club. One premiership (by one point) and 28 wooden spoons in 128 years is a grim record. In four of those spoon years, they won no games. In another four, they won one game, and also have two seasons with one win and one draw. They've played in 17 finals series and won 22 finals. They've lost 6 Grand Finals including their last four.

Your justified resentment of Hawthorn is explained here. Hawthorn have won seven of their last eight Grand Finals going back to 1988. In the same time period, Sydney Swans have also played eight Grand Finals and won only two. Hawthorn's entire VFL/AFL record is 13 premierships and 6 losses from 19 Grand Finals, all in the last 65 years. One premiership every five years is excessive. They are overdue for losing a few.
